Nabil Bank and Bhaktapur Chamber of Commerce sign MOU; bank commits to provide all sort of banking services for development of commerce and industries

Thu, Feb 20, 2020 9:37 AM on Corporate, Latest,

Nabil Bank Ltd. & BCCI have jointly conducted an interaction program at BCCI Building, Byasi, Bhaktapur  on 18 February, 2020. Mr. Anil Keshary Shah, CEO, Nabil Bank and Mr. Pradip Shrestha, President, BCCI signed an agreement on the said program.

With signing of this agreement, Nabil Bank has committed to support for fostering the development of Trade, Service and Industrial service in Nepal thereby providing various gamut of banking services including Loan to Small and Medium Enterprises (SME), Micro Enterprises and Mid Corporate business houses. During this ceremony, Chief Executive Officer of the Bank said “We see a lot of potential in further developing our nation’s trade & industrial sector this being the backbone of Nepalese economy. The bank will be supportive to institutions engaged in Trade, Service & Industrial sector in Bhaktapur. Nabil Bank is privileged to have signed an MOU with BCCI to work together to provide the need financial services and facilities for their growth.”

President of BCCI said, “We are happy to announce Nabil Bank as the partner bank for improving overall economic activities in Bhaktapur District”.  

Nabil Bank is providing its services through a wide domestic network of 114 branches, 166 ATMs, more than 1500 Nabil Remit agents throughout the nation and many correspondents across the globe. The bank believes in moving “Together Ahead” with all its stakeholders.
